Kansas To Launch School Mental Health Pilot Program

On April 17, 2018, Kansas Governor Jeff Colyer signed the state’s school funding bill, which includes a provision to launch a pilot school mental health program in six school districts. The goal is to expand mental health services for students. The bill provides funding of $10 million for the pilot, in which schools will partner with community mental health centers (CMHCs) to provide services. The CMHCs will work with the school districts on two program tracks, one for all students, and one for students in foster care.
